Bidfood’s e-learning platform reaches 10,000 users

bidfood

Bidfood’s e-learning and development platform, Caterers Campus, surpassed 10,000 users as operators invest to help manage rising costs and ongoing staffing pressures.

Created to support customers across the hospitality and public sector with engaging and flexible training, Caterers Campus launched in 2020 for the care sector during the Covid-19 pandemic to ensure learning could continue when face-to-face training was no longer possible.  The platform has since expanded across 12 sectors and now features 35 specialist modules, covering food safety, cost control, sustainability, leadership and mental wellbeing.

Modules have been developed by Bidfood’s in-house specialists, including Development Chefs, registered Nutritionists, sustainability experts and compliance professionals; ensuring training is practical, relevant and immediately applicable in real kitchen environments.

Joe Angliss, customer marketing controller at Bidfood, said: “Reaching 10,000 users is a fantastic achievement for Caterers Campus and a reflection of how much the hospitality industry values flexible learning and development. We know our customers are under pressure balancing rising costs, staffing challenges and changing consumer behaviour while continuing to deliver high standards.

“What sets Caterers Campus apart is the expertise behind the content. Caterers Campus was created to remove barriers to learning by making training flexible, engaging and completely free for our customers. We’re proud to see so many businesses using the platform to invest in their people, strengthen operational performance and support their long-term growth.”
